  • Service Type Selection Risk Choosing the wrong service type, such as opting for sea shipping when express delivery is critical, often leads to missed deadlines and dissatisfied clients; align your choice strictly with your delivery urgency and cargo nature.

  • Provider Negotiation Leverage Insist on clarifying the exact role of the service provider—whether it's a major player like DHL or a specialized freight forwarder—as this affects reliability, coverage, and potential hidden fees.

  • Insurance Coverage Norms In practice, most reputable providers offer insurance around 0.3% of the total commercial invoice value, so be wary of options lacking clear coverage or those charging ambiguous formulas like Goods Value * 1.1 * 0.001.

  • Price Versus Service Trade-off While prices as low as $20 or steep discounts over 50% may seem attractive, choosing the right price point directly affects service quality and risk mitigation, especially for international business clients requiring dependable global shipping.
